Fiestro Tours offers a comprehensive Vietnam tour package that covers all major tourist destinations in Vietnam. The package includes accommodation, transportation, sightseeing, and other travel services.

The tour begins in Hanoi, the capital of Vietnam, where visitors can explore the ancient architecture of the Old Quarter, the Ho Chi Minh Mausoleum, and the Temple of Literature. The tour then takes visitors to Halong Bay, a UNESCO World Heritage Site famous for its stunning limestone cliffs and clear blue waters. Visitors can go kayaking, swimming, or simply relax on the cruise ship.

The next stop is Hoi An, an ancient city on the central coast of Vietnam. Hoi An is known for its well-preserved traditional architecture, lanterns, and silk shops. Visitors can take a walking tour of the old town or learn how to make traditional lanterns.

The tour then continues to Ho Chi Minh City, the largest city in Vietnam. Visitors can explore the Cu Chi Tunnels, a network of underground tunnels used during the Vietnam War, or visit the War Remnants Museum, which documents the country's history.

Finally, the tour ends with a visit to the Mekong Delta, the "rice bowl" of Vietnam. Visitors can experience the local culture by taking a boat tour along the canals, visiting local markets, and trying traditional Vietnamese food.

Overall, Fiestro's Vietnam tour package offers a diverse and comprehensive experience of Vietnam's culture, history, and natural beauty.

PM Tour with Local Lunch: Cu Chi Tunnels Located 60km from HCMC, Cu Chi is now a popular spot for both Vietnamese & foreign tourists - the network of over 200km of tunnels became legendary when they played a vital role in the War. In their heyday, the tunnels were functioning underground cities including numerous trap doors, specially constructed living areas, storage facilities, weapons factories, field hospitals, command centers & kitchens. Today, ducks and water buffalos happily coexist in the rivers along the side of the road. However, the peaceful rural rice paddy scenery belies the area’s violent history. Visitors will find it hard to imagine the destruction, damage & defoliation over this whole area, caused by bombing and mines. There is plenty of evidence of the fierce battle that took place here during the 1960s when Cu Chi was a Free Target Zone. Start our tour in the morning, before entering the tunnels visitors can watch a short introductory video showing how the tunnels were constructed. You will spend the next hour exploring the tunnels. Afterwards, enjoy tea, cassava (guerrilla’s food during the war). Return to Sai Gon.
